Helping Reactive Dogs Feel Safe and Seen – Ethical, Effective Support for Dog-to-Dog Reactivity

If your dog barks, lunges, freezes, or simply can’t cope around certain people, dogs, or situations, it can feel overwhelming. But reactivity is far more common than most guardians realise, and it’s rooted in emotion, not disobedience. Dogs react this way when they’re scared, confused, frustrated, or unsure how to handle what’s happening around them.

My role is to help you understand why your dog behaves like this. Together, we look at what’s fuelling those big reactions, things like stress, fear, frustration, past experiences, or difficulty processing the world when excitement rises. Once we understand the “why”, we can start to gently shift how your dog feels in those moments.

The goal is simple:
help your dog feel safer, more secure, and more capable of choosing calmer responses.

We work at your dog’s pace, making life easier for them emotionally and easier for you practically. Over time, you’ll start to see your dog thinking more clearly, settling more quickly, and coping better around everyday triggers. Walks become calmer, your confidence grows, and your dog learns that the world isn’t as overwhelming as it once felt.
